Distance from Yerevan to Salerno
There are several ways to calculate the distance from Yerevan to Salerno. Here are two standard methods:
Vincenty's formula (applied above)- 1548.718 miles
- 2492.419 kilometers
- 1345.799 nautical miles
Vincenty's form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points on the earth's surface using an ellipsoidal model of the planet.
Haversine formula- 1544.815 miles
- 2486.138 kilometers
- 1342.407 nautical miles
The haversine form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points assuming a spherical earth (great-circle distance – the shortest distance between two points).
